Brief summary
The purpose of this study is to do determine the changes in physiological and optical properties in healthy pre-menopausal breast tissue during the menstrual cycle using Diffuse Optical Spectroscopy. The Researcher can determine 1) how large variations in breast tissue components are 2) how predictable and repeatable these variations are 3) the effects of endogenous hormones on breast tissue physiology.
Detailed description
Variations in breast physiology due to hormonal fluctuations during the menstrual cycle can correlate to quantitative changes in Diffuse Optical Spectroscopy functional parameters such as hemoglobin, lipid and water concentration and tissue scattering. Diffuse Optical Spectroscopy imaging can show increase blood flow in breast tissue after ovulation with a concomitant increase in mitotic activity, changes in hemoglobin concentration and in tissue scattering. Increases in fibroglandular breast tissue after ovulation have also been observed. Diffuse Optical Spectroscopy imaging can determine after time of ovulation has been detected during the two months of self-monitoring.

Eligibility
Inclusion criteria
* Pre-Menopausal female 18 years of age or older with normal breast tissue * Undergoes regular menstrual cycle cycles that do not vary by more than 5 days
Exclusion criteria
* Peri-Menopausal and Post-Menopausal * Subjects taking oral contraceptives or any birth control medications in the past six months * Diagnosed with breast cancer or cancer survivor,a history of breast surgery * Subjects taking light sensitive drugs for photodynamic therapy
